
The global market for Land GNSS Correction Services was valued at US$ 430 million in the year 2023 and is projected to reach a revised size of US$ 665 million by 2030, growing at a CAGR of 6.5% during the forecast period.
Terrestrial GNSS correction service refers to the global navigation satellite system (GNSS) signal correction service provided to terrestrial users. GNSS, or Global Navigation Satellite System, is the core of modern navigation and positioning technology, consisting of a series of satellites, ground monitoring stations and user equipment. It transmits signals through satellites, ground monitoring stations receive signals and provide relevant data, and user equipment receives satellite signals and calculates accurate position and time information.
